Rain jacket materials have changed a lot since the early 19th-century ideas from Charles Macintosh. He started using rubber-layered fabrics to make the first useful waterproof clothes. Now, new developments offer many synthetic and mixed materials. These fit certain needs. Types of Rain Jacket Materials and Their Features
A few main materials meet wholesale and manufacturing demands. Each has clear strengths.
PVC (Polyvinyl Chloride)

PVC stays common for tough rainwear. It blocks water fully and fights oils, chemicals, and scrapes. Often picked for work suits, bright safety clothes, and cover ponchos, PVC Rain Jacket gives sure waterproofing (usually 5,000–10,000mm hydrostatic head) at good prices. But it has poor breathability. This can cause inside sweat in long use. Strength works well in rough settings. Yet bend drops in cold. PVC fits big orders for job safety or sea uses.
Polyurethane (PU) Coated Fabrics
PU layers add a slim waterproof cover to base cloths like polyester or nylon. This mixes low cost with firm water block (often 3,000–8,000mm). PU raincoat gives more breath than PVC in small-hole types. It also backs light builds. Seen in average work clothes and promo raincoats, PU layers allow changes like color fits or logo adds. Weak points cover slow layer wear over time. But new types add DWR for better last.
Polyester
Polyester leads cheap, fast-dry rainwear. When given DWR covers or joined, it shows solid water push and no-wrinkle traits. Polyester’s range backs mixes and layers. This makes it great for big making. It dries quick and fights color loss. It fits promo or daily retail lines. Breathability grows with open threads. But plain polyester needs extra steps for full waterproofing.
Nylon
Nylon brings top strength-to-weight links. Ripstop kinds raise rip fight. Often mixed with PU or other layers, nylon shines in light, foldable plans fit for trips or outdoor promos. Its lasting beats many polyesters in scrape spots. DWR steps lift push-back. Nylon fits tasks needing move without big size.
Polyethylene (PE) and EVA
PE gives cheap, light one-time or half-reuse choices. It often goes in quick ponchos or promo items. EVA adds more bend and green traits in some types. Both stress carry ease and low price for big orders. Yet they miss breath or long life of layered synthetics.

Advanced Membranes (e.g., Gore-Tex, eVent)
Top membranes give great waterproofing (20,000mm+) with high breath. They use small-hole builds. These multi-layer setups shine in strong outdoor tools. But they cost more and fit small markets.
Softshell Fabrics
Softshells stress move and breath with water-push (not full block) traits. Great for active work clothes or mixed use, they add stretch and warm backs for ease in changing weather.

Breathability Ratings and Testing
Breathability (set in g/m²/24h) matters for move or long-use rainwear. Materials with small-hole membranes beat full layers in vapor pass.
Waterproof Ratings
Water head numbers guide fit: 5,000mm deals with fair rain, while 10,000mm+ holds big storms. Full joined edges raise whole strength.

FAQ
What is the most durable rain jacket material for industrial applications?
PVC and nylon with reinforced coatings offer excellent abrasion and chemical resistance, making them suitable for heavy-duty workwear.
How does PU coating compare to PVC in terms of breathability?
PU coatings, especially microporous variants, provide better vapor transmission than solid PVC, reducing internal moisture buildup.
Which material is best for lightweight, packable rainwear in bulk orders?
PE, EVA, or lightweight nylon/polyester options excel in portability and cost-efficiency for promotional or travel lines.
What waterproof rating should manufacturers target for heavy rain performance?
Aim for at least 5,000–10,000mm hydrostatic head, with taped seams, for reliable protection in prolonged exposure.
Are eco-friendly materials available for wholesale raincoats?
Yes, recyclable PE/EVA variants and low-impact coatings meet growing sustainability requirements without sacrificing functionality.
